Spaghetti Garlic Bread Bowls

A fun and delicious combination of spaghetti and garlic bread in an edible bowl, perfect for family dinners or gatherings.

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: Italian
Calories: 520

Ingredients

For the Spaghetti Filling

  • 8 oz Spaghetti Cook according to package instructions
  • 1 lb Ground beef
  • 4 rolls Garlic bread rolls Hollowed out for filling
  • 1 cup Shredded cheese Choose your preferred type of cheese
  • 2 tbsp Olive oil For sautéing
  • 3 cloves Garlic Minced
  • 1 medium Onion Chopped
  • 1 tsp Salt To taste
  • 1 tsp Pepper To taste
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ning To taste

Method

Preparation

  • Cook spaghetti according to package instructions.
  • In a sk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add chopped onion and minced garlic, and sauté until fragrant.
  • Add ground beef to the skillet and cook until browned. Drain excess fat.
  • Stir in cooked spaghetti. Season with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ning.
  • Hollow out the garlic bread rolls and fill them with the spaghetti mixture.
  • Top with shredded cheese.

Baking

  •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 15 minutes, or until the bread is crispy and the cheese is melted.

Serving

  • Serve warm, right out of the oven. Optionally, add a simple salad or garlic dipping sauce on the side.

Notes

Make sure to not overcook the spaghetti; it should be al dente. Experiment with different cheeses and add vegetables for more flavor and nutrition. Store leftovers wrapped in plastic or in an airtight container; they last up to three days in the refrigerator.
